PC Games vs. Mobile Games: Which Gaming Platform Reigns Supreme?

The gaming landscape has evolved tremendously over the last decade. Once dominated by traditional consoles and PCs, the market is now also flooded with mobile games that attract millions of players globally. This article aims to delve deep into the comparison between PC games and mobile games, examining their advantages, challenges, and gaming experiences. Whether you’re a die-hard PC gamer or someone who prefers gaming on their mobile device, there’s compelling information ahead.

The Rise of Mobile Gaming

Mobile gaming has truly become a phenomenon. With the introduction of smartphones and tablet devices, games are now more accessible than ever. According to recent statistics, nearly 60% of global gamers play on mobile devices, showcasing an unprecedented growth trajectory.

PC Games: The Classic Choice

While mobile gaming is on the rise, PC games maintain their allure. PCs offer powerful graphics, extensive storage capacity, and superior processing power. This makes them the preferred choice for serious gamers, especially those who enjoy games that demand high performance and intricate graphics.

A Coherent Comparison: Key Features

Here’s a closer look at some of the critical features that distinguish both gaming platforms:

Feature PC Games Mobile Games
Graphics Quality Excellent Good
Game Variety Extensive Moderate
Accessibility Moderate High
Control Options Flexible Limited

Best Games with Rich Stories on PC

If you are looking for games that offer a rich narrative experience, here are some of the best games known for their exceptional story-telling:

  • The Witcher 3: Wild Hunt - A deep plot set in a captivating world.
  • Red Dead Redemption 2 - A compelling tale of outlaws and redemption.
  • The Last of Us - An emotional journey through a post-apocalyptic landscape.
  • Dark Souls Series - Intricate lore wrapped in challenging gameplay.

The Evolution of RPGs: 2013 and Beyond

The role-playing game (RPG) genre has undergone significant changes since 2013. Games released in that year, such as Diablo III and Final Fantasy XIV, have set standards that many modern titles still strive to meet. These games connect players with expansive worlds and gripping storylines.

Mobile Gaming Pros: On-the-Go Fun

Mobile games offer unique advantages that can’t be ignored:

  • Portability - Play anywhere, anytime.
  • User-Friendly - Designed for quick sessions, perfect for busy lifestyles.
  • Free-to-Play Options - Many mobile games are available at no cost.

Challenges Faced by PC Gamers

While PC gaming has many advantages, it’s not without its downsides:

  • Cost - PCs can be expensive to build or upgrade.
  • Space Requirements - Requires a dedicated space.
  • Maintenance - PCs need regular updates and maintenance.

The Community Factor

Community is essential in gaming. PC gamers often have access to vast online communities, forums, and modding options that enhance their gaming experience. In contrast, mobile games tend to create smaller communities, often centered around app stores or developer forums.

How Indie Games are Shaping Both Platforms

Indie games have surged in popularity across both platforms. Titles like Hades on PC and Among Us on mobile showcase innovation and creativity. They often blend genres and provide unique gameplay experiences. What connects these games is their ability to break conventional rules and engage audiences like never before.

Future Trends in Gaming

The future of gaming seems bright, with both PC and mobile platforms evolving. Expect to see advancements in cloud gaming and AR/VR technology that could bridge the gap between these platforms. The lines between them are blurring, giving gamers the flexibility to choose.
